Some ignorant mourning wailers are saying floating the naira is same as devaluing it. Hell NO!

If you devalue the Naira, you fix an official exchange rate to it. E.g N250 to a dollar. With that approach, the black market rate will jump to beyond N400 to a dollar.

But with floating, many traders with high volume of dollars come in and trade dollars based on demand. In this approach, there is no official dollar rate set by the government. The rate is purely determined by how much dollars are demanded and how much dollars are available. This way, the Naira finds its true value.
